Beyond the status quo
2025-03-27

After outlining different metropolitan governance models in the first volume of this series, this second report focuses on presenting three innovative approaches to metropolitan governance that call to move beyond the status quo of rigid, fragmented administrative models. By integrating these approaches as complementary tools, they can help urban leaders implement transformative policies aimed at improving quality of life.

A citymakers’ guide to… the Care Economy
What is the cost of overlooking care?2025-03-27

What is the cost of overlooking care? The care economy is all the critical social infrastructure – paid and unpaid – that keeps societies running, making all other work possible. This policy brief examines the risks that cities face if care systems remain underfunded and undervalued, and offers real case examples that showcase how cities around the world are addressing the global care crisis.

Redefining metropolitan governance in the 21st century
2025-01-21

This paper calls for a shift in how we conceptualise and implement metropolitan governance. By embracing adaptable and innovative approaches, aligning with global goals and recognising the dynamic nature of metropolitan life, governments can pave the way for resilient and sustainable communities. Metropolitan governance is not just about addressing current issues; it is also about laying the groundwork for generations to come.
